Performance Breakdown: Insta360 X4 Vs Rylo 360 For Vloggers And Content Creators

Choosing the right 360-degree camera is essential for vloggers and content creators aiming to deliver immersive and high-quality content. Two popular options on the market are the Insta360 X4 and the Rylo 360. This article provides a detailed performance breakdown to help creators decide which device best suits their needs.

Design and Build Quality

The Insta360 X4 features a compact, lightweight design with a robust build that is resistant to water and dust, making it ideal for outdoor adventures. Its ergonomic shape allows for easy handling during filming sessions.

The Rylo 360, on the other hand, boasts a sleek, minimalist design with a focus on portability. Its smaller form factor makes it easy to carry around, though it offers less ruggedness compared to the X4.

Video Quality and Stabilization

The Insta360 X4 records in up to 5.7K resolution at 30fps, providing sharp and detailed footage. Its FlowState stabilization technology ensures smooth videos even during dynamic movements.

Rylo 360 captures videos in 5.8K resolution at 30fps, with its advanced stabilization system delivering ultra-smooth footage. However, some users report slightly more cropping in the final video compared to the Insta360 X4.

Ease of Use and User Interface

The Insta360 X4 offers a user-friendly interface with a touchscreen display, making it easy to preview shots and adjust settings on the fly. Its companion app provides robust editing tools.

Rylo 360’s app interface is intuitive, with simple controls for recording and editing. Its minimalistic design appeals to users who prefer straightforward operation without extensive customization.

Battery Life and Storage

The Insta360 X4 provides approximately 60 minutes of continuous recording on a single charge, with expandable storage via microSD cards up to 1TB.

Rylo 360 offers around 70 minutes of recording time and also supports microSD cards, though its maximum supported capacity is slightly lower at 512GB.

Additional Features

The Insta360 X4 includes features like HDR video, night mode, and horizon leveling, enhancing versatility in various shooting conditions.

Rylo 360 emphasizes its seamless editing capabilities, with features like automatic stabilization and easy sharing options, making post-production straightforward.

Price and Value

The Insta360 X4 is priced higher, reflecting its advanced features and rugged design, making it suitable for professional content creators.

Rylo 360 offers a more affordable option with excellent stabilization and decent video quality, appealing to casual vloggers and hobbyists.

Conclusion

Both the Insta360 X4 and Rylo 360 are capable devices for content creators seeking immersive video experiences. The X4 excels in ruggedness, video quality, and feature set, making it ideal for professional use. The Rylo 360 provides excellent stabilization and ease of use at a lower price point, suitable for hobbyists and casual creators.
